Bob Boken Biography

Bob Boken
Bob Boken
  • Born Feb. 23, 1908

Boken (of Lithuanian descent) was born in Maryville, Illinois and played youth ball in the Maryville Little League. He was on the Senators rosters for the 1933 World Series but did not appear in any of its games.
The Senators were the surprise team of 1933, breaking a seven-year monopoly on the AL title jointly held by the New York Yankees and Philadelphia Athletics from 1926 to 1932. Led by future Hall of Famer Joe Cronin, the Senators amassed a 99–53 record and theIr first pennant in eight years, besting the Babe Ruth- and Lou Gehrig-led New York Yankees by seven games.
Boken's first game on April 25, 1933 had him coming in to relieve Joe Cronin at SS, in a home game against the New York Yankees.  Boken had one AB and didn't reach the bases in a game where Ruth and Gehrig combined with 4 hits and 5 RBIs  to trounce the Senators 16 to 0.
